Movatterモバイル変換


[0]ホーム

URL:


CN102148772A - Synchronous notification method for community platform and instant messaging server - Google Patents

Synchronous notification method for community platform and instant messaging server
Download PDF

Info

Publication number
CN102148772A
CN102148772ACN2011101046066ACN201110104606ACN102148772ACN 102148772 ACN102148772 ACN 102148772ACN 2011101046066 ACN2011101046066 ACN 2011101046066ACN 201110104606 ACN201110104606 ACN 201110104606ACN 102148772 ACN102148772 ACN 102148772A
Authority
CN
China
Prior art keywords
instant messaging
communication server
targeted customer
file
instant communication
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
CN2011101046066A
Other languages
Chinese (zh)
Inventor
胡加明
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Suzhou Codyy Network Technology Co Ltd
Original Assignee
Suzhou Codyy Network Technology Co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Suzhou Codyy Network Technology Co LtdfiledCriticalSuzhou Codyy Network Technology Co Ltd
Priority to CN2011101046066ApriorityCriticalpatent/CN102148772A/en
Publication of CN102148772ApublicationCriticalpatent/CN102148772A/en
Pendinglegal-statusCriticalCurrent

Links

Images

Landscapes

Abstract

The invention provides a synchronous notification method for a community platform and an instant messaging server. The synchronous notification method for the community platform comprises the following steps that: source users log in the community interaction platform according to registration information, call application program codes, load the registration information and make requests to the instant messaging server; the instant messaging server returns instant messaging related data and resources to a webpage, and the webpage resolves the obtained instant messaging related data and resources to generate an instant messaging tool; the source users transmit files to be processed to the instant messaging server by the instant messaging tool according to preset priorities; the instant messaging server processes the files to be processed in batches to obtain compressed files; and the instant messaging server synchronously notifies target users by the instant messaging tool after finishing the batch processing, wherein the number of the source users is at least two.

Description

A kind of synchronization notice method and instant communication server of community platform
Technical field
The present invention relates to network field, relate in particular to a kind of synchronization notice method and instant communication server of community platform.
Background technology
Progressively development along with social network, the mode that people carry out information interchange is also varied, for example: the immediate communication tool that downloads and installs, as MSN, QQ, POPO has been subjected to everybody liking deeply, and it provides new approach for people's communication, information interchange, is another the important information interchange mode except mobile phone, fixed line, Email.By these instruments, the user can realize single or many people video, can hold the network teleconference, can carry out network remote education, can also allow the interchange cost between people and the people reduce greatly, and improve efficient.In the process that people exchange mutually, the transmission of file is more and more frequent, and the amount of transmission is also increasing.Therefore, use a kind of transmission means fast and efficiently to seem particularly important.Yet there is obvious defects in traditional transmission means, and for example, the part instrument need be installed client just can carry out file transfer, and the part instrument can not merge file unified the download, and the part instrument can't realize transmitting at different user the function of different files.
For example, application number is that 200810117459.4 Chinese invention patent discloses a kind of file download service method and system.Above-mentioned file download service method may further comprise the steps.The downloading request message that file download service device receiving terminal sends.Wherein, downloading request message comprises the information of end message and request file in download.When terminal has the authority of download, will ask the information of file in download to be sent to the file packing apparatus.The file packing apparatus will be asked the downloaded files packing according to the information of request file in download, and the file address after the packing is sent to the file download service device.File after the file download service device will be packed according to the described address that receives is sent to terminal.
Yet, there is following shortcoming in existing file transfer means: 1, existing file transfer means need be installed client software and just can be carried out file transfer, some indescribable software can be by the terminal that is installed in oneself unawares, thereby influences the fail safe of computer; 2, existing webpage only has that file is uploaded, download function, lacks compression function, if quantity of documents is bigger, then needs the user repeatedly to click page request and downloads, thereby cause many unnecessary operations; 3, when source user need send to a plurality of targeted customer with file, need repeat to select file waiting for transmission, and carry out repeatedly squeeze operation, be not easy to operation; 4, the targeted customer need inquire ceaselessly that whether server end finishes packing process, wastes targeted customer's time easily.
Summary of the invention
The invention provides a kind of synchronization notice method of community platform and instant communication server to address the above problem.
The invention provides a kind of synchronization notice method of community platform.The synchronization notice method of community platform may further comprise the steps.Source user is according to log-on message login community interaction platform, and the invokes application code imports log-on message into and asks instant communication server.Instant communication server returns instant messaging related data and resource to webpage, and webpage is resolved instant messaging related data and the resource that obtains, and generates immediate communication tool.Source user sends pending file to instant communication server according to default priority by immediate communication tool.The pending file of instant communication server batch process is to obtain compressed file.Instant communication server passes through immediate communication tool synchronization notice targeted customer after finishing batch process.Wherein, the number of source user is at least two.
The present invention also provides a kind of instant communication server, comprises generation module, memory module and batch process module.Generation module is used for returning instant messaging related data and resource to webpage according to the log-on message that imports into.Wherein, importing into by source user of log-on message realizes according to log-on message login community interaction platform invokes application code, and webpage is resolved instant messaging related data and the resource that obtains, the generation immediate communication tool.The batch process module connects generation module, and the pending file that batch process module batch process source user sends by immediate communication tool to be obtaining compressed file, and after finishing batch process by immediate communication tool synchronization notice targeted customer.Memory module connects the batch process module, and memory module is stored pending file and compressed file.
Compared to prior art, synchronization notice method and instant communication server according to community platform provided by the present invention, because instant communication server is finished pending files in batches and is handled the back by immediate communication tool synchronization notice targeted customer, therefore, the targeted customer need not ceaselessly to inquire whether server end finishes the batch process operation, has saved targeted customer's time better.In addition,, in operating process, need not to repeat to select file waiting for transmission, avoid simultaneously carrying out repeatedly identical squeeze operation, thereby made things convenient for operation when targeted customer's number when being a plurality of.In addition, the present invention has realized need not to download any software, can realize instant messaging, has improved the fail safe and the convenience of network communication.
Description of drawings
Accompanying drawing described herein is used to provide further understanding of the present invention, constitutes the application's a part, and illustrative examples of the present invention and explanation thereof are used to explain the present invention, do not constitute improper qualification of the present invention.In the accompanying drawings:
Figure 1 shows that flow chart according to the synchronization notice method of the community platform shown in the preferred embodiment of the present invention;
Figure 2 shows that schematic diagram according to the instant communication server shown in the preferred embodiment of the present invention.
Embodiment
Hereinafter will describe the present invention with reference to the accompanying drawings and in conjunction with the embodiments in detail.Need to prove that under the situation of not conflicting, embodiment and the feature among the embodiment among the application can make up mutually.
Figure 1 shows that flow chart according to the synchronization notice method of the community platform shown in the preferred embodiment of the present invention.Figure 2 shows that schematic diagram according to the instant communication server shown in the preferred embodiment of the present invention.Please in the lump with reference to figure 1 and Fig. 2.
As shown in Figure 1, the synchronization notice method of the community platform that provides of preferred embodiment of the present invention comprises step S100~S106.In step S100, source user lands community's interaction platform, generates immediate communication tool automatically.Particularly, source user is logined according to the log-on message at community's interaction platform.Wherein, community's interaction platform includes but not limited to: personal portal; Log-on message includes but not limited to: mailbox, password.
For example, source user is logined according to mailbox, password at personal portal.Simultaneously, according to the API that embeds on the webpage (Application Programming Interface, application programming interface) code, import mailbox, the encrypted message of source user into.API code request instant communication server, instant communication server returns instant messaging related data (user setup data, good friend's data, group's data etc.) and resource (comprising CSS, script file, picture etc.) to webpage, webpage is according to the rule of the pattern (skin) of door, data and resource are resolved and shown, generate immediate communication tool.Wherein, immediate communication tool is based on that webpage generates, and need not to download any client software, thereby avoids some indescribable software by the terminal that is installed in oneself unawares, with the fail safe of assurance computer.
In step S101, source user sends pending file to instant communication server according to default priority by immediate communication tool.Wherein, priority is default by the keeper.The number of source user is at least two.Yet the present invention does not do any qualification to this.
In step S102, the pending file of instant communication server batch process is to obtain compressed file.In step S103, instant communication server passes through immediate communication tool synchronization notice targeted customer after finishing batch process.Particularly, after pending files in batches compression was finished, instant communication server was finished and can be downloaded by immediate communication tool synchronization notice targeted customer batch process.So, the targeted customer need not ceaselessly to inquire whether the instant communication server batch process is finished, thereby has saved targeted customer's time.In addition, the file batch process in the present embodiment is realized by instant communication server.Yet the present invention is not limited thereto.In other embodiment, also can realize by other data processing servers.
In present embodiment, when the targeted customer receives after instant communication server finishes the notice of batch process, the targeted customer selects whether to receive compressed file (as step S104).If the targeted customer agrees to receive compressed file, then instant communication server is sent to targeted customer (as step S105) by immediate communication tool with the address of compressed file, thereby the prompting targeted customer downloads.Instant communication server also can pass through immediate communication tool notification source ownership goal user's download situation simultaneously.If the targeted customer rejects compressed file, then instant communication server is rejected compressed file (as step S106) by immediate communication tool notification source ownership goal user.Particularly, when instant communication server synchronization notice targeted customer, the immediate communication tool on targeted customer's page can be jumped out the dialog box that whether receives compressed file.If targeted customer's selective reception, then immediate communication tool is jumped out the address that prompting frame shows compressed file again; If the targeted customer selects refusal, then the immediate communication tool on the source user page is jumped out prompting frame notification source ownership goal user and is rejected compressed file.
As shown in Figure 2, the instant communication server 102connection management persons 100, source user 101a~101b and the targeted customer 103a~103c that provide of preferred embodiment of the present invention.In this, be that example describes with two source user 101a~101b and three targeted customer 103a~103c.Yet the present invention is not limited thereto, and is at least two as long as guarantee the number of source user.For example,keeper 100 to set in advance the priority of source user 101a~101b be that the priority of source user 101a is higher than source user 101b.In other words, as source user 101a, when 101b all need upload pending file, source user 101a enjoyed the right of preferentially uploading.Specifically be that example describes with the Web conference.In the Web conference process, ifsource user 101a, 101b all needs transfer files to targeted customer 103a~103c,keeper 100 can be by immediate communication tool in the mode of prompting frame in source user 101a, the progress of uploading of uploading order and respective sources user of the pending file of page prompts of 101b.In view of the above, each source user can in time be uploaded corresponding pending file according tokeeper 100 notice.
In addition, the instant communication server 102 that provides of preferred embodiment of the present invention comprisesgeneration module 1020,receiver module 1021, memory module 1022, batch process module 1023,sending module 1024 and removing module 1025.Particularly, thereceiver module 1021 of instant communication server 102 connectsgeneration module 1020 and memory module 1022 batch process modules 1023 connect memory module 1022 andsending module 1024, and removing module 1025 connects memory module 1022.Wherein, thegeneration module 1020 of instant communication server 102 is used for returning instant messaging related data and resource to webpage according to the log-on message that imports into.Wherein, importing into by source user 101 of log-on message realizes according to log-on message login community interaction platform invokes application code, and webpage is resolved instant messaging related data and the resource that obtains, the generation immediate communicationtool.Receiver module 1021 is used for receiving pending file from source user 101.The pending file that batch process module 1023 batch process source users 101 send by immediate communication tool, and after finishing batch process, pass through immediate communication tool synchronization notice targeted customer 103a~103c.Memory module 1022 is used to store pending file that is received from source user 101 and the compressed file that obtains through batch process module 1023 batch process.After finishing batch process, batch process module 1023 passes through immediate communication tool synchronization notice targeted customer 103a~103c, and after targeted customer 103a~103c determined to receive compressed file, sendingmodule 1024 was sent to targeted customer 103a~103c with the address of compressed file.Removing module 1025 is the deletion compressed file after targeted customer 103a~103c receives compressed file or when targeted customer 103a~103c does not receive compressed file above the ticket reserving time.
In sum, the synchronization notice method and the instant communication server of the community platform that preferred embodiment according to the present invention provides, because instant communication server is finished pending files in batches and is handled the back by immediate communication tool synchronization notice targeted customer, therefore, the targeted customer need not ceaselessly to inquire whether server end finishes the batch process operation, has saved targeted customer's time better.In addition,, in operating process, need not to repeat to select file waiting for transmission, avoid simultaneously carrying out repeatedly identical squeeze operation, be very easy to operation when targeted customer's number when being a plurality of.In addition, the present invention has realized need not to download any software, can realize instant messaging, has improved the fail safe and the convenience of network communication.
The above is the preferred embodiments of the present invention only, is not limited to the present invention, and for a person skilled in the art, the present invention can have various changes and variation.Within the spirit and principles in the present invention all, any modification of being done, be equal to replacement, improvement etc., all should be included within protection scope of the present invention.

Claims (10)

3. the synchronization notice method of community platform according to claim 1, it is characterized in that, when described instant communication server by the described targeted customer of described immediate communication tool synchronization notice, and when described targeted customer agrees to receive described compressed file, described instant communication server is sent to described targeted customer with the address of described compressed file, when described instant communication server by the described targeted customer of described immediate communication tool synchronization notice, and when described targeted customer rejected described compressed file, described instant communication server notified the described targeted customer of described source user to reject described compressed file.
CN2011101046066A2011-04-262011-04-26Synchronous notification method for community platform and instant messaging serverPendingCN102148772A (en)

Priority Applications (1)

Application NumberPriority DateFiling DateTitle
CN2011101046066ACN102148772A (en)2011-04-262011-04-26Synchronous notification method for community platform and instant messaging server

Applications Claiming Priority (1)

Application NumberPriority DateFiling DateTitle
CN2011101046066ACN102148772A (en)2011-04-262011-04-26Synchronous notification method for community platform and instant messaging server

Publications (1)

Publication NumberPublication Date
CN102148772Atrue CN102148772A (en)2011-08-10

Family

ID=44422782

Family Applications (1)

Application NumberTitlePriority DateFiling Date
CN2011101046066APendingCN102148772A (en)2011-04-262011-04-26Synchronous notification method for community platform and instant messaging server

Country Status (1)

CountryLink
CN (1)CN102148772A (en)

Cited By (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
CN103036763A (en)*2011-09-302013-04-10腾讯数码(天津)有限公司Method and system for pulling precipitation user in social networking services (SNS) community

Citations (8)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20040015610A1 (en)*2002-07-182004-01-22Sytex, Inc.Methodology and components for client/server messaging system
CN101116051A (en)*2004-08-152008-01-30徐永永 resource-based virtual community
CN101217554A (en)*2008-01-142008-07-09张尧森An instant communication method realized on website
CN102137036A (en)*2011-04-252011-07-27苏州阔地网络科技有限公司priority level-setting instant communication synchronic informing method and instant communication server
CN102185790A (en)*2011-04-252011-09-14苏州阔地网络科技有限公司Instant message processing and transmitting method with priority and instant messaging server
CN102185789A (en)*2011-04-252011-09-14苏州阔地网络科技有限公司Method for performing transmission according to priorities in instant messaging and instant messaging server
CN102238168A (en)*2011-04-112011-11-09苏州阔地网络科技有限公司Synchronous notification method based on community platform and instant communication server
CN102244618A (en)*2011-04-122011-11-16苏州阔地网络科技有限公司Batch processing method and instant messaging server based on community platform

Patent Citations (8)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20040015610A1 (en)*2002-07-182004-01-22Sytex, Inc.Methodology and components for client/server messaging system
CN101116051A (en)*2004-08-152008-01-30徐永永 resource-based virtual community
CN101217554A (en)*2008-01-142008-07-09张尧森An instant communication method realized on website
CN102238168A (en)*2011-04-112011-11-09苏州阔地网络科技有限公司Synchronous notification method based on community platform and instant communication server
CN102244618A (en)*2011-04-122011-11-16苏州阔地网络科技有限公司Batch processing method and instant messaging server based on community platform
CN102137036A (en)*2011-04-252011-07-27苏州阔地网络科技有限公司priority level-setting instant communication synchronic informing method and instant communication server
CN102185790A (en)*2011-04-252011-09-14苏州阔地网络科技有限公司Instant message processing and transmitting method with priority and instant messaging server
CN102185789A (en)*2011-04-252011-09-14苏州阔地网络科技有限公司Method for performing transmission according to priorities in instant messaging and instant messaging server

Cited By (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
CN103036763A (en)*2011-09-302013-04-10腾讯数码(天津)有限公司Method and system for pulling precipitation user in social networking services (SNS) community

Similar Documents

PublicationPublication DateTitle
CN102185789A (en)Method for performing transmission according to priorities in instant messaging and instant messaging server
CN102970362A (en)Method and device for sharing cloud data
CN103338276A (en)Method for data transmission between network terminals
CN102185790A (en)Instant message processing and transmitting method with priority and instant messaging server
CN102271095A (en)Community platform-based batch processing transmission method and instant communication server
CN102137045A (en)Method and system for implementing group information interaction on community platform
CN102137040A (en)Priority level-setting instant communication transmission control method and instant communication server
CN102244618A (en)Batch processing method and instant messaging server based on community platform
CN102244617A (en)Batch processing notification method based on community platform and live communications server
CN102185913A (en)Instant messaging file processing method with priority and instant messaging server
CN102130852A (en)Batch processing and transmitting method for community platform and instant communication server
CN102148772A (en)Synchronous notification method for community platform and instant messaging server
CN102130851A (en)Method for controlling batch processing of community platform and instant communication server
CN102158429A (en)Community platform based group communication method and system
CN102137042A (en)Instant messaging processing notification method with priority and instant messaging server
CN102238168A (en)Synchronous notification method based on community platform and instant communication server
CN102130850B (en)File transmission method for community platform and instant messaging server
CN102130849B (en)Method for transmitting file of community platform and instant communication server
CN102137046A (en)Priority level-setting instant communication file transmission method and instant communication server
CN102238101A (en)Community-platform-based file transmission method and instant messaging server
CN102333045A (en)Group information interaction method and system of community network
CN102137036A (en)priority level-setting instant communication synchronic informing method and instant communication server
CN102255940A (en)Priority based file batch processing transmission method and system
CN102255882A (en)Method and system for transmitting batch-processed files
CN102185912A (en)Batch processing method based on community platform and instant communication server

Legal Events

DateCodeTitleDescription
C06Publication
PB01Publication
C10Entry into substantive examination
SE01Entry into force of request for substantive examination
C02Deemed withdrawal of patent application after publication (patent law 2001)
WD01Invention patent application deemed withdrawn after publication

Application publication date:20110810


[8]ページ先頭

©2009-2025 Movatter.jp